Default Dumb question about frost-free freezers

Why does the defrost cycle not also defrost the food in the freezer? If I understand it correctly, those freezers periodically heat up to melt the frost, then cool off again. How can this be good for the food...?

The thermal mass of the frozen food keep it cold for the defrost duration. The freezer fan never works during defrost; If it did, all your frozen food would defrost.
